I’ve found my ideal format for shipping apps for personal & family use: PWAs, with an offline-first focus, rendering (mostly) entirely client-side. JavaScript is powerful enough to do pretty much anything these days - especially if you don’t have to write the code yourself.
PWAs#

So what am I shipping: a mobile-only web application, with long client-side caching & a simple update mechanism. Add the website to your mobile phone’s home screen, and it behaves 99% like a native application, but is so much easier to maintain, deploy & install. Our family is all-in on the Apple ecosystem, so sideloading apps isn’t a rabbit hole I want to go down. But PWAs install with just 2 clicks.

Non-negotiables for building PWAs#
My core lessons learned after iterating on this for a bit:
- Offline-first: assume there’s no internet connectivity, apps should load in < 1s and never be blocked by the network (
fetch().catch(-> cache)only fires when you’re truly offline; a slow network can still block for ~10s) - Simple hash-based updates: since we’re offline-first, a background fetch for a version check is needed. Show a simple top banner when a new app version is available, it’ll refresh the PWA and boom, app updated. Always serve from cache, refetch in the background
- Ensure sufficient spacing from the top, for the iPhone notch/camera (unusable top space)
- Add a simple PWA install prompt to each tool (I pulled mine out into pwa-install-prompt )
- Avoid iOS’s “copy to clipboard” when not needed, by applying correct CSS
- No webfonts
Lessons learned, as an agent skill#
Over the past few weeks I’ve grown the CLAUDE.md of that repo into a full set of rules that every tool in it follows. I’ve pulled them out into their own repo: github.com/mattiasgeniar/offline-first-pwa .
It’s an agent skill, so you can clone it into ~/.claude/skills/ and have Claude Code apply it to whatever you’re building, or point any other AGENTS.md-reading tool at it. It’s also just a checklist you can read. Service worker caching strategy, precaching, in-app update prompts, iOS home screen quirks, safe areas, and how to test any of it. Every rule in there is something I got wrong first.
